Dwarf Spurge
Euphorbia exigua
Arable land at Castor, Peterborough, Cambridgeshire
23
views
0
faves
0
comments
Uploaded on August 19, 2017
Taken on June 23, 2017
Dwarf Spurge
Euphorbia exigua
Arable land at Castor, Peterborough, Cambridgeshire
23
views
0
faves
0
comments
Uploaded on August 19, 2017
Taken on June 23, 2017